Why are the fact sheets on frugal innovation not included in this chapter?
Frugal innovation is a design trend defined by the pursuit of savings in use and expenditure throughout a product's life cycle. It involves simplifying a product's features to meet the essential needs of end users while reducing costs, and is primarily applied in emerging countries. Frugal innovation seeks in particular to save materials and energy, but achieving better environmental performance is not systematic. In cases where it is achieved, this is unintentional.
